Introducing the Eater 38, your answer and ours to any question that begins, "Can you recommend a restaurant?" This highly elite group covers the entire city, spans myriad cuisines and collectively satisfies all of your restaurant needs, save for those occasions when you absolutely must spend half a paycheck (i.e. no fine dining, save one extraordinary spot). Every couple of months, we'll update the list with pertinent restaurants that were omitted, have newly become eligible (restaurants must be open at least six months) or have stepped up their game.

And so, without further ado (and in no particular order), we present the Chicago Eater 38.
